AI for Pre-Call Prospect Research & Summarization
One of the most practical applications of AI in the sales process is gathering and summarizing prospect data before calls. These tools excel at data summarization without interfering with the human relationship aspect of selling:
ChatGPT
- Key Feature: Summarizes PDFs and web pages, extracts key insights, and drafts personalized email openers based on a prospect's LinkedIn profile
- Practical Application: Feed a prospect's latest press release or annual report into ChatGPT and ask for a summary of key challenges and opportunities, generating instant talking points that demonstrate your preparation
- Best For: Sales reps who need quick insights from large volumes of text
Gemini (formerly Bard)
- Key Feature: Summarizes long email threads to catch up on an account's history and analyzes documents from Google Drive
- Practical Application: Before a follow-up call, use Gemini to summarize the entire email history with a prospect, ensuring no detail is missed and conversations pick up seamlessly
- Best For: Teams deeply integrated with Google Workspace
PitchBook
- Key Feature: Provides detailed company profiles, funding information, M&A activity, and market trends
- Practical Application: Essential for B2B sales teams to understand a prospect's financial health, recent investments, and strategic priorities to tailor a high-value pitch
- Best For: Enterprise sales targeting funded startups or companies considering acquisition

AI for Intelligent Lead Generation & Data Enrichment
Finding the right prospects is half the battle in top of funnel sales activities. These AI tools automate the process of discovering and qualifying leads:
Seamless.AI
- Key Feature: Focuses on social media insights and data segmentation for targeted campaigns while enriching lead profiles with verified contact information
- Practical Application: Automatically identify decision-makers at target companies and obtain their verified contact details without manual LinkedIn searching
- Best For: B2B companies that rely heavily on social selling and need accurate contact data
LeadIQ
- Key Features: Syncs with LinkedIn for B2B lead generation and validates data in real-time
- Practical Application: Capture prospect information while browsing LinkedIn and export it directly to your CRM with a single click
- Best For: Sales teams living on LinkedIn Sales Navigator for their prospecting efforts
Intent Detection Tools
These AI systems analyze online behaviors (website visits, content downloads, competitor research) to identify buying signals for timely outreach. This moves beyond static lists to dynamic, intent-based prospecting that dramatically increases conversion rates.
Community-Vetted Stack
Sales professionals overwhelmed by options recommend this practical combination:
- List Source: Sales Navigator or Apollo
- Enrichment: Airscale or Clay
- Outreach: Smartlead, Heyreach, or LaGrowthMachine
This stack provides a cost-effective foundation for lead generation, enrichment, and cold outreach that actual users trust and recommend.

Putting It Into Practice: Building an AI-Powered Top-of-Funnel Workflow
To transform these tools from interesting concepts into revenue-generating assets, here's a step-by-step framework for building an AI-powered sales workflow:

Step 1: Lead Collection
Automate scraping leads from sources like LinkedIn Sales Navigator or Apollo. Set parameters for your ideal customer profile to ensure relevance.
Step 2: AI Qualification & Enrichment
Use an AI model to analyze each lead's profile against predefined criteria (industry, company size, job title). Automatically disqualify poor fits to focus your efforts. Use enrichment tools like Clay to find verified emails and additional data points.
Step 3: Hyper-Personalized Outreach
Feed enriched data into an AI prompt to generate personalized first-touch emails. Include variables like {firstName}, {companyName}, and {recentAchievement} to avoid generic messaging. This directly counters the reality that "mass outreach is dead" in today's market.
Step 4: Human Review & Execution
Have AI-generated emails populate a draft folder for a human sales rep to review. Before sending, reps should use this messaging to practice their delivery. Platforms like Hyperbound allow reps to roleplay conversations with an AI buyer, ensuring they are prepared for objections and can articulate value confidently. This step maintains quality control and equips reps with the skills to master the human touch that distinguishes successful outreach.
Step 5: Follow-Up & Tracking
Use an outreach tool like Smartlead to automate email sequencing for follow-ups. Track opens, clicks, and replies to measure effectiveness and continuously improve your approach.
How to Implement AI Tools Without Alienating Your Team
Sales reps may resist AI tools, especially if they feel forced into reading a script or engaging in a transactional sale that diminishes their expertise. Here's how to foster adoption:
Implement AI Gradually
Start with tools that solve immediate pain points (like research automation) to reduce seller stress and demonstrate clear value. Begin with one use case that shows tangible time savings.
Provide a Safe Space to Practice
Introduce AI tools that allow reps to practice new skills in a risk-free environment. AI roleplay platforms, for example, let reps try out new messaging or practice objection handling without the pressure of a live customer call. This builds confidence and competence, making them more receptive to adopting new playbooks and technologies.
Audit Current Processes
Identify where your team spends the most time on low-value tasks. Target these areas first for AI implementation to show clear efficiency gains that allow reps to focus on building relationships.
Build Team Trust
Foster a "technology-as-a-teammate" culture. Use storytelling to show how AI has helped other reps win deals. Don't just mandate usage; demonstrate the benefits through real success stories that highlight how AI enhances rather than replaces human sales abilities.
